Why is the America’s Cup Partnership such a big deal? (Or is it the beginning of the end….)

Again in August the Protocol for the thirty eighth America’s Cup was lastly agreed and signed. Inside it had been particulars of a significant structural change to the America’s Cup: the formation of a brand new Partnership, however that was solely lastly agreed final week. Matt Sheahan analyses why it is essential

Regardless of wanting like one other bland piece of America’s Cup politics and process, it’s troublesome to overstate the importance of the newly shaped America’s Cup Partnership (ACP).

First revealed a number of weeks in the past within the thirty eighth America’s Cup Protocol, the ACP modifications essentially the way in which during which the Cup shall be run within the subsequent cycle and past.

And whereas there are good causes for the change, it’s not going to be universally common. The truth is, this may very well be essentially the most controversial Cup transfer in trendy occasions, some say it might even be the start of the tip for the Auld Mug as we all know it.

Sir Ben Ainslie, who has performed a significant half in creating the ACP – and whose crew Athena Racing represents the Royal Yacht Squadron, the Challengers of File – says that is, “The most important step change within the historical past of the Cup,” and that the ACP is, “Crucial to the longer term success of the Cup.”

His reverse, Grant Dalton, CEO of Emirates Group New Zealand representing the Defenders, the Royal New Zealand Yacht Squadron is equally punchy. “If we hadn’t have performed this it might have been just about the tip of the Cup.”Each are daring statements and each will increase loads of remark and fierce debate.

Spreading the load

Historically, in the event you win the America’s Cup you tackle the duty for placing on the subsequent occasion as soon as a Challenger has thrown down the gauntlet.

It’s an enormous obligation, each logistically and financially and places big strain on each the Defenders and the membership they characterize, particularly in multi-challenger Cup cycles the place the burden of internet hosting an occasion that runs for months can place big calls for on infrastructure.

Protecting the massive monetary prices is made even more durable because the short-term nature of a Cup cycle that lacks any element makes it particularly troublesome for sponsors to justify placing their fingers of their pockets.

Which means that the timeframe between America’s Cup matches inevitably will get drawn out, which in flip causes its personal issues in relation to sustaining public curiosity within the occasion. Filling these gaps with extra occasions prices more cash and so the issue continues to spiral.

The ACP seeks to vary this by sharing the logistical and monetary burden with the opposite opponents.

In easy phrases, underneath the brand new construction when a Challenger enters the America’s Cup it takes a spot on the board that governs the occasion. From right here the foundations, the schedule, the venue choice and each different element of the cycle is agreed and actioned.

Dalton and Ainslie argue that this creates future construction to the occasion round which internet hosting offers might be made for future venues together with long run sponsorship offers and different monetary concerns.

Additionally they argue that prices might be higher managed and speak of spending caps which they are saying would assist to extend the variety of future potential groups.

Not distinctive?

All of which sounds optimistic, particularly on condition that that is how SailGP, which was born out of the 2017 America’s Cup, is at the moment rising.

However there are these that can argue that democratising the America’s Cup strikes on the coronary heart of its basis.

Commercialising it on this means, and working a Cup occasion each two years as has been prompt, dangers turning it into one other world championships of crusing and removes the winner-takes-all facet that has drawn a gentle stream of billionaires for 174 years.

The attraction and potential business advantage of successful the Cup and bringing it house may be gone if internet hosting offers have been made for future cycles. This might additionally scale back the attraction and status of the Cup making it more durable to lift funds.

Large cash offers

However Dalton and Ainslie don’t see it this fashion.

“We might dearly have beloved to have the ability to negotiate with Naples for 2 cycles,” says Dalton. “Their infrastructure invoice is €180 million, however when you may solely plan for one cycle you may’t do lengthy broadcast offers and you’ll’t do lengthy sponsor offers which is the well-known Achilles heel of the Cup.

“So, on this business world – and realizing that our sport is area of interest – we knew it was time to make that transfer. And so together with the Challenger of File with help from the New York Yacht Membership we have now been in a position to do it nevertheless it’s not been straightforward as a result of there’s quite a lot of stakeholders to be glad.”

Ainslie agrees. “The problem has been attempting to persuade stakeholders that that is the fitting transfer for the Cup,” he says.

“Initially there was various resistance for a lot of completely different causes and it’s taken 12 months to get so far. However as onerous because it’s been, truly the conviction from Grant that that is what we ought to be doing has delivered on the finish of the day.”

However these are massive modifications, and even Dalton has his issues. “We knew that if we didn’t do something then we’d not have a Cup in 10 years time.

“So, ultimately this was a name that we needed to make however you received’t be capable to persuade me that we’re proper but, I feel solely time will inform.”
